We may earn an affiliate commission when you visit our partners.
Course image
Udemy logo

Python in Excel 2023 Masterclass for Data Science

Alexander Hagmann

Unlock the Power of Data Science and Finance with Python in Excel 2023 - the BRAND-NEW Excel Feature.

Read more

Unlock the Power of Data Science and Finance with Python in Excel 2023 - the BRAND-NEW Excel Feature.

Are you ready to take your data analysis and visualization skills to the next level? Welcome to the "Python in Excel 2023 Masterclass for Data Science," the ultimate course that empowers Excel users to seamlessly integrate Python into their workflow for enhanced data manipulation, analysis, visualization, and machine learning.

Course Highlights:

Harness the Synergy: Dive into the future of data science by merging Excel's familiar interface with the limitless possibilities of Python programming.

Data Transformation: Learn how to effortlessly load, clean, and transform your data using Python libraries, supercharging your data preparation processes.

Advanced Analytics: Master the art of statistical analysis and machine learning within Excel using Python's powerful libraries, opening up new horizons for predictive modeling and decision-making.

Data Visualization: Create stunning charts, graphs, and interactive dashboards using Python's data visualization libraries to tell compelling data stories.

Financial Analytics: Perform more complex Finance and Investment workflows within Excel using Python's powerful libraries

Seamless Integration: Discover how to seamlessly integrate Python scripts into your Excel workbooks and automate repetitive tasks, saving you time and effort.

Combination with other powerful Tools: Complementary usage of the brand-new Python in Excel together with xlwings will boost your projects.

Who Is This Course For?

  • Excel enthusiasts looking to expand their skill set and explore Python's data analysis capabilities.

  • Data analysts, business analysts, and finance professionals wanting to leverage Python's advanced analytics tools without leaving the Excel environment.

  • Data science aspirants eager to gain hands-on experience in using Python for real-world data projects.

  • Anyone seeking to enhance their career prospects by mastering the latest data analysis techniques.

Why Choose This Course?

  • Up-to-date Content: Stay ahead of the curve with the latest Python integration features in Excel 2023.

  • Practical Learning: Dive into hands-on projects and exercises that reinforce your skills.

  • Expert Guidance: Benefit from the knowledge of experienced instructors who simplify complex concepts.

  • Certificate of Completion: Showcase your newfound skills with a Udemy certificate upon course completion.

Instructor Profile:

Your course instructor, Alexander Hagmann, is a seasoned data scientist and finance professional with >15 years of experience in both Excel and Python. He has designed this course to help you bridge the gap between Excel and Python, making data analysis and visualization more accessible and powerful than ever before.

Note: This course assumes a basic understanding of Excel and some prior knowledge of Python. A valid Microsoft 365 Subscription on a Windows machine is needed (MAC and Linux are currently not supported. )

Enroll now

What's inside

Learning objectives

  • Set up and use the brand-new python in excel feature
  • Use powerful python data science tools (pandas, seaborn, scikit-learn) directly in excel
  • Explanatory data analysis (eda) and data visualization with python in excel
  • Statistics, hypothesis tests and machine learning with python in excel
  • Financial data and time series analysis with pandas in excel
  • Merging, aggregating and manipulating tabular data with pandas in excel
  • Combining the brand new python in excel feature with other powerful tools (xlwings)

Syllabus

Getting started
Welcome
How to get the most out of this course
Sneak Preview: Merging and joining Data with Pandas in Excel
Read more
Python in Excel: How it works & what you need
Python in Excel: Features & alternative Tools (xlwings)
How to set up Python in Excel (BETA)
Troubleshooting
Python in Excel - First Steps and Must Knows
Introduction
Simple Operations using the PY Function
Python Variables vs. Excel Cell References
Python Objects and Data Types
NoneType Objects
Output Types: Python Output vs. Excel Value
Extracting Data from Python Objects to Excel
Diagnostics
Calculation Order and Recalculation
Initialization Settings and Customizations
User-defined Functions and Classes
Python Plots (Matplotlib & Seaborn)
Project 1: Explanatory Data Analysis (EDA) with Python and Excel
Project Introduction and Downloads
Instructions and Hints
Excursus: Project Solution in a Jupyter Notebook
Task 1: How to load and import the Dataset
Task 2: Initial Data Inspection
Task 3: Univariate Data Analysis 1
Task 4: Univariate Data Analysis 2
Task 5: Multivariate Data Analysis 1
Task 6: Multivariate Data Analysis 2
Task 7: Multivariate Data Analysis 3
Project 2: Time Series and Financial Data Analysis with Python in Excel
Task 1: How to load the Dataset and Initial Data Inspection
Task 2: How to create dynamic Price Charts
Task 3: Dynamic Resampling and Financial Returns
Task 4: Statistics and Performance Analysis
Task 5: Covariance and Correlation Matrix and Heatmaps
Project 3: Merging and aggregating Data with Pandas in Excel
Task 1: Creating and Aggregating DataFrames
Task 2: Creating a tool to join/merge Datasets with full flexibility
Project 4: Multiple Regression Analysis, Hypothesis Testing and Preprocessing
Project Introduction, Downloads and Hints
Coding Solution (Part 1)
Coding Solution (Part 2)
Coding Solution (Part 3)
Implementation & Feature Elimination in Excel (Part 1)
Implementation & Feature Elimination in Excel (Part 2)
Bonus Project: Using Python in Excel and xlwings together - the ultimate Boost
Introduction and Downloads
Set up and Installation of xlwings
How to use xlwings as a Data Viewer
Data Viewer - Update
How to connect to an Excel Workbook
How to read and write single Values
Introduction to Running Python Scripts in Excel & Downloads
Installing the xlwings add-in and other preparations
Running Python Scripts with "Run main"
Bonus Project: Introduction & Downloads
Instruction and Hints
Solution
Appendix: Installing and working with Anaconda and Jupyter Notebooks
Download and Install Anaconda
How to open Jupyter Notebooks
How to work with Jupyter Notebooks
What´s next? (outlook and additional resources)
Bonus Lecture

Good to know

Know what's good
, what to watch for
, and possible dealbreakers
Taught by an experienced instructor with 15 years in Excel and Python, who simplifies complex concepts
Focuses on practical learning through hands-on projects and exercises
Up-to-date with the latest Python integration features in Excel 2023
Teaches merging and joining data with Pandas, a powerful data manipulation and analysis library
Best suited for Excel users looking to expand their skill set and explore Python's data analysis capabilities
Requires a valid Microsoft 365 Subscription on a Windows machine (MAC and Linux are not supported)

Save this course

Save Python in Excel 2023 Masterclass for Data Science to your list so you can find it easily later:
Save

Reviews summary

Python in excel 2023: data science masterclass

Learners say this course goes deeply into the Python programming language and its applications in data science, making it a valuable resource for those looking to enhance their skills in this field. The course is well-structured and easy to follow, featuring engaging lectures and practical demonstrations that help learners grasp the concepts effectively. The instructor, Mark Casey, is knowledgeable, patient, and engaging, making the learning process enjoyable and informative. Students appreciate the thorough coverage of topics such as data manipulation, visualization, and machine learning algorithms. The course also provides hands-on exercises and real-world examples that allow learners to apply their newly acquired skills to practical scenarios. Overall, students highly recommend this course to anyone interested in advancing their knowledge and skills in Python for data science applications.
Well-structured and easy-to-follow course
"The course is well-structured and easy to follow, featuring engaging lectures and practical demonstrations that help learners grasp the concepts effectively."
Knowledgeable, patient, and engaging instructor
"The instructor, Mark Casey, is knowledgeable, patient, and engaging, making the learning process enjoyable and informative."
Thorough coverage of Python and its applications in data science
"Learners say this course goes deeply into the Python programming language and its applications in data science, making it a valuable resource for those looking to enhance their skills in this field."
"The course is well-structured and easy to follow, featuring engaging lectures and practical demonstrations that help learners grasp the concepts effectively."
"Students appreciate the thorough coverage of topics such as data manipulation, visualization, and machine learning algorithms."
"The course also provides hands-on exercises and real-world examples that allow learners to apply their newly acquired skills to practical scenarios."

Activities

Be better prepared before your course. Deepen your understanding during and after it. Supplement your coursework and achieve mastery of the topics covered in Python in Excel 2023 Masterclass for Data Science with these activities:
Course Materials Compilation
Improves organization and facilitates effective review of course content.
Show steps
  • Gather notes, assignments, quizzes, and exams from class.
  • Organize materials into a coherent and easily accessible format.
Python Fundamentals
Reinforces basic Python skills and concepts.
Browse courses on Python
Show steps
  • Review Python variables, data types, and operators.
  • Practice writing simple Python functions.
  • Run through hands-on exercises in a Python environment.
Python for Data Analysis
Provides a comprehensive foundation in Python for data analysis.
Show steps
  • Read chapters related to data manipulation, visualization, and machine learning.
  • Work through practice exercises and examples.
Six other activities
Expand to see all activities and additional details
Show all nine activities
Data Science Workshop
Provides hands-on experience and networking opportunities with data science professionals.
Browse courses on Data Science
Show steps
  • Attend a data science workshop to learn advanced techniques.
  • Connect with experts and fellow learners to exchange knowledge and ideas.
Interactive Data Visualization Dashboard
Demonstrates proficiency in data visualization and storytelling.
Browse courses on Data Visualization
Show steps
  • Select and prepare a dataset for visualization.
  • Design and implement interactive charts and graphs.
  • Integrate Python code to enhance visualization capabilities.
  • Test and refine the dashboard for usability and effectiveness.
Excel Integration with Python
Develop proficiency in integrating Python functionality into Excel.
Browse courses on Excel
Show steps
  • Follow tutorials on how to set up and use Python in Excel.
  • Practice loading and manipulating data using Python within Excel.
  • Experiment with Python libraries for data analysis and visualization within Excel.
  • Build a project using Python and Excel to analyze and visualize data.
Data Analysis Drills
Improves data analysis skills and strengthens understanding of Python libraries.
Browse courses on Data Analysis
Show steps
  • Solve exercises involving data cleaning and transformation.
  • Practice data visualization using Python libraries like Matplotlib and Seaborn.
  • Apply machine learning techniques using Python libraries like scikit-learn.
  • Analyze and interpret data analysis results.
Stock Market Analysis Project
Develop practical skills in financial data analysis and machine learning.
Browse courses on Financial Data Analysis
Show steps
  • Gather and clean historical stock market data.
  • Analyze data to identify trends and patterns.
  • Apply machine learning algorithms to predict stock movements.
  • Evaluate and interpret results, and develop trading strategies.
  • Present findings and recommendations in a report or presentation.
Contribute to Python Data Science Open Source Projects
Encourages collaboration and deepens understanding of Python.
Browse courses on Python
Show steps
  • Identify open source projects related to Python data science.
  • Contribute code, documentation, or bug fixes.
  • Collaborate with other contributors and learn from their expertise.

Career center

Learners who complete Python in Excel 2023 Masterclass for Data Science will develop knowledge and skills that may be useful to these careers:
Financial Analyst
A Financial Analyst evaluates and makes recommendations on investment opportunities. This course may be useful for aspiring Financial Analysts as it covers the use of Python for financial data analysis. By learning how to use Python in Excel, you can gain the skills necessary to analyze financial data, identify trends, and make informed investment decisions.
Machine Learning Engineer
A Machine Learning Engineer designs, develops, and deploys machine learning models. This course may be useful for aspiring Machine Learning Engineers as it provides hands-on experience in using Python for machine learning tasks. By learning how to use Python with Excel, you can gain the skills necessary to build and deploy machine learning models that solve real-world problems.
Quantitative Analyst
A Quantitative Analyst develops and applies mathematical and statistical models to analyze financial data. This course may be helpful for aspiring Quantitative Analysts as it provides an introduction to using Python for data analysis and modeling. By mastering these skills, you can build a solid foundation for a career in quantitative finance.
Operations Research Analyst
An Operations Research Analyst uses mathematical and analytical techniques to solve complex business problems. This course may be useful for aspiring Operations Research Analysts as it covers the use of Python for optimization and simulation. By learning how to use Python in Excel, you can gain the skills necessary to develop and apply mathematical models to improve business outcomes.
Data Engineer
A Data Engineer designs and builds the infrastructure and systems that store, process, and analyze data. This course may be helpful for aspiring Data Engineers as it covers the use of Python for data manipulation and processing. By learning how to use Python in Excel, you can gain the skills necessary to build and maintain data pipelines and ensure the integrity and accessibility of data.
Data Analyst
A Data Analyst collects, processes, and analyzes data to identify trends, patterns, and relationships. This course can be helpful for aspiring Data Analysts as it provides a hands-on introduction to using Python and Excel for data analysis. By mastering these tools, you'll gain the skills necessary to transform raw data into actionable insights, a crucial aspect of data analysis.
Statistician
A Statistician collects, analyzes, interprets, and presents data to help businesses and organizations make informed decisions. This course may be useful for aspiring Statisticians as it covers the use of Python for statistical analysis. By learning how to use Python with Excel, you can gain the skills necessary to perform complex statistical analyses and develop data-driven solutions.
Data Visualization Specialist
A Data Visualization Specialist designs and creates data visualizations to communicate insights effectively. This course may be useful for aspiring Data Visualization Specialists as it covers the use of Python for data visualization. By learning how to use Python in Excel, you can gain the skills necessary to create visually appealing and informative data visualizations that help stakeholders make better decisions.
Data Governance Analyst
A Data Governance Analyst develops and implements policies and procedures to ensure the quality, security, and integrity of data. This course may be helpful for aspiring Data Governance Analysts as it covers the use of Python for data management and processing. By learning how to use Python in Excel, you can gain the skills necessary to build and maintain data governance frameworks that protect and enhance the value of data.
Risk Analyst
A Risk Analyst identifies, analyzes, and manages risks for businesses and organizations. This course may be helpful for aspiring Risk Analysts as it covers the use of Python for data analysis and modeling. By learning how to use Python in Excel, you can gain the skills necessary to develop and implement risk management models that assess and mitigate risks.
Data Scientist
A Data Scientist employs machine learning, artificial intelligence, statistics, and advanced programming to extract insights from structured and unstructured data. This course may be useful for aspiring Data Scientists as it covers the basics of Python, a popular programming language used in data science, and its integration with Excel, a widely used spreadsheet application. By learning how to use Python with Excel, you can leverage the strengths of both tools to perform complex data analysis, modeling, and visualization tasks.
Actuary
An Actuary analyzes and manages risk for insurance companies and other financial institutions. This course may be helpful for aspiring Actuaries as it covers the use of Python for financial data analysis and modeling. By learning how to use Python in Excel, you can gain the skills necessary to develop and implement actuarial models that assess and mitigate risk.
Business Intelligence Analyst
A Business Intelligence Analyst uses data analysis to identify trends, patterns, and relationships that can help businesses make better decisions. This course may be beneficial for aspiring Business Intelligence Analysts as it provides a foundation in using Python and Excel for data analysis and visualization. By mastering these tools, you can develop the skills needed to extract insights from data and communicate them effectively to stakeholders.
Data Science Manager
A Data Science Manager leads a team of data scientists and is responsible for the overall success of data science projects. This course may be helpful for aspiring Data Science Managers as it provides a comprehensive overview of the data science process, from data collection and analysis to model deployment. By gaining a deep understanding of data science principles and best practices, you can effectively lead and manage data science teams.
Business Analyst
A Business Analyst identifies and solves business problems through data analysis and process improvement. This course may be beneficial for aspiring Business Analysts as it covers the use of Python and Excel for data manipulation and visualization. By learning how to use these tools effectively, you can develop the skills needed to analyze business data, identify inefficiencies, and propose data-driven solutions.

Reading list

We've selected 15 books that we think will supplement your learning. Use these to develop background knowledge, enrich your coursework, and gain a deeper understanding of the topics covered in Python in Excel 2023 Masterclass for Data Science.
Provides comprehensive coverage of Python libraries and tools for data analysis, including NumPy, Pandas, Matplotlib, and Seaborn.
Introduces the fundamental concepts of machine learning and provides hands-on experience with popular Python libraries for machine learning, such as Scikit-Learn, Keras, and TensorFlow.
Provides a comprehensive guide to machine learning with Python, covering a wide range of topics from data preparation to model evaluation.
Covers a wide range of topics in data science, including data cleaning, feature engineering, machine learning, and data visualization.
Provides a gentle introduction to data science concepts and Python programming, making it suitable for beginners with no prior experience in the field.
Provides a comprehensive overview of computer vision concepts and algorithms, making it suitable for beginners with no prior experience in the field.
Provides a comprehensive overview of speech and language processing concepts and algorithms, making it suitable for beginners with no prior experience in the field.
Provides a comprehensive overview of information theory, inference, and learning algorithms, making it suitable for beginners with no prior experience in the field.
Provides a comprehensive overview of Bayesian data analysis concepts and algorithms, making it suitable for beginners with no prior experience in the field.
Provides a comprehensive overview of causal inference concepts and algorithms, making it suitable for beginners with no prior experience in the field.
Provides a comprehensive overview of statistical learning methods, including supervised and unsupervised learning algorithms.
Provides a comprehensive overview of deep learning concepts and algorithms, making it suitable for beginners with no prior experience in the field.
Provides a comprehensive overview of reinforcement learning concepts and algorithms, making it suitable for beginners with no prior experience in the field.
Provides a comprehensive overview of natural language processing concepts and algorithms, making it suitable for beginners with no prior experience in the field.

Share

Help others find this course page by sharing it with your friends and followers:

Similar courses

Here are nine courses similar to Python in Excel 2023 Masterclass for Data Science.
Python for Excel: Use xlwings for Data Science and Finance
Most relevant
Interactive Python Standard Library
Most relevant
Assessment for Data Analysis and Visualization Foundations
Most relevant
Python For Marketing
Most relevant
Modern Data Analyst: SQL, Python & ChatGPT for Data...
Most relevant
The Complete Pandas Bootcamp 2024: Data Science with...
Most relevant
Plots Creation using Matplotlib Python
Most relevant
Try It: Intro to Python
Most relevant
Build Your First Data Visualization with Pygal 2
Most relevant
Our mission

OpenCourser helps millions of learners each year. People visit us to learn workspace skills, ace their exams, and nurture their curiosity.

Our extensive catalog contains over 50,000 courses and twice as many books. Browse by search, by topic, or even by career interests. We'll match you to the right resources quickly.

Find this site helpful? Tell a friend about us.

Affiliate disclosure

We're supported by our community of learners. When you purchase or subscribe to courses and programs or purchase books, we may earn a commission from our partners.

Your purchases help us maintain our catalog and keep our servers humming without ads.

Thank you for supporting OpenCourser.

© 2016 - 2024 OpenCourser